York Notes Advanced offer a fresh and accessible approach to English Literature. This market-leading series has been completely updated to meet the needs of today's A-level and undergraduate students. Written by established literature experts, York Notes Advanced intorduce students to more sophisticated analysis, a range of critical perspectives and wider contexts.

what more can i say? although this cannot be a substitute for the actual book it certainly goes a long way when trying to understand the main themes and the characters. of course you cannot just learn the book by heart and expect to acheive the highest grade - your own opinions are vital and this book is just an aid in forming your own ideas.
the book has improved a lot from its last edition and now has many new features including examiners tips, "did you know?" and useful insights into the authors life and how this would have affected her writings.

Its good and extremely useful for A-level students. It really helped me understand what was going on in terms off which character was which, this at first I'd found icreasingly confusing and frustrating. Its also a good method of finding quotes (once you know the storyline) as its chapter summary helps you find the part of the novel you need as you can't always remember when a certain scene took place. Then its easy to read through again and find an appropriate quote without having to leaf through the whole novel repeatedly.
Also has really useful info on themes discussed in the novel which help inspire your own opinions and give you new ideas.
